María Custodio is a scholar working on Pollution, Water Science and Technology and Ecology. According to data from OpenAlex, María Custodio has authored 64 papers receiving a total of 657 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 22 papers in Pollution, 20 papers in Water Science and Technology and 12 papers in Ecology. Recurrent topics in María Custodio's work include Heavy metals in environment (20 papers), Water Quality and Pollution Assessment (17 papers) and Heavy Metal Exposure and Toxicity (5 papers). María Custodio is often cited by papers focused on Heavy metals in environment (20 papers), Water Quality and Pollution Assessment (17 papers) and Heavy Metal Exposure and Toxicity (5 papers). María Custodio collaborates with scholars based in Peru, Chile and Spain. María Custodio's co-authors include Richard Peñaloza, Carlos Cacciuttolo, Keng Pee Ang, J.M. Elliot, Nicolas Derôme, François‐Étienne Sylvain, Frank C. Powell, Simon Creer, Carolina Falcón García and Gary R. Carvalho and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Scientific Reports and Soil Biology and Biochemistry.
